The Quiet Minecraft Streamer Building Community Through Lifesteal SMP Adventures

ECorridor has quietly carved out his own space in the Minecraft streaming world, building a dedicated community around his laid-back approach to one of gaming's most popular sandbox experiences. With over 3,000 followers on Twitch, this content creator has found his groove in the competitive landscape of Minecraft streamers, though he's never been one to chase the biggest numbers or loudest trends.

The Lifesteal Connection

What really sets ECorridor apart is his involvement in the Lifesteal SMP, a hardcore Minecraft server where players can literally steal hearts from each other. He joined as one of eight new members during Season 6 and has continued his journey into Season 7, where he's currently flying solo as an independent player. The Lifesteal community knows him simply as "E," and his presence there has helped him build genuine connections with other creators and viewers who appreciate the high-stakes gameplay that comes with potentially losing everything.

Beyond Twitch

The creator isn't limited to just streaming, maintaining a presence on YouTube where his bio playfully reads "ruining a YouTuber UHC even." This hint at his involvement in Ultra Hardcore events suggests he's not afraid to mix things up and participate in the broader Minecraft community events that bring creators together for intense, elimination-style gameplay. His willingness to engage in these competitive formats shows there's more depth to his content than casual building sessions.
